22 - ATR142 - User manual
8.12 Dual action heating-cooling
ATR142 is suitable also for systems requiring a combined
heating-cooling action.
Main command output must be configured foe hearting PID
(
act.t.
=
Heat
and
p. b .
must be greater than 0), and one of the
alarms (
A L .1
or
AL. 2
) must be configured as
co o L.
Command
output must be connected to the actuator responsible for
heat, while the alarm output will control cooling action.
Parameters to configure for the Heating PID are:
act.t.
=
Heat
Command output type (Heating)
p. b.
: Heating proportional band
t.i .
: Integral time of heating and cooling
t.d.
: Derivative time of heating and cooling
t. c.
: Heating time cycle
The parameters to configure for the Cooling PID are the
following (example: action associated to alarm1):
AL.1
=
cooL
Alarm1 selection (cooling)
p.b.m.
: Proportional band multiplier
ou.d.b.
: Overlapping/Dead band
co.t.c.
: Cooling time cycle
Parameter
p.b.m.
(that ranges from 1.00 to 5.00) determines
the proportional band of cooling basing on the formula:
Cooling proportional band =
p. b.
*
p.b.m.
This gives a proportional band for cooling which will be the
same as heating band if
p.b.m.
= 1.00, or 5 times greater if
p.b.m.
= 5.00. The integral time and derivative time are the
same for both actions.
Parameter
ou.d.b.
determines the overlapping percentage
between the two actions. For systems in which the heating
and cooling output must never be simultaneously active a
dead band (
ou.d.b.
≤ 0) can be configured, and viceversa an
overlapping (
ou.d.b.
> 0).
